I have recently found a 1936 indian head nickel with the date stamped on the left hand side is this rare?

Answer

Indian Head 5 cent
Hello Mary,                                     

The date is supposed to be on the coins left bottom area below the neck on the bust of the Indian.
Where the date goes and which way the head faces is the artist’s choice on the coin. There is no rule.
